An Elementary Approach For Sums Of Consecutive Cubes Being Prime Power Squares

General Mathematics 2024-01-10 v1

Abstract

This paper proposes an elementary solution to a special case of finding all perfect squares that can be written as sum of consecutive integer cubes. It is shown that there are no non-trivial solutions if the perfect square is a prime power, i.e., it is divisible by two different primes if a non-trivial one exists. Solution mostly depends on vp(x)v_{p}(x) and general forms of Pythagorean triples.
